Each event will showcase no more than 12 teams seeded into three pools. The top-two teams from each pool will advance to the afternoon single-elimination bracket, from which the champion and runner-up teams will each be awarded a bid. This weekend presents great opportunities for eight of ITVC’s nine teams as four teams will compete for a bid to the Girls’ Junior National Championships, while four others will compete for a region championship crown.
The Puget Sound Region implemented the bid tournament for the 2012 season, to create an event for qualified teams to compete for the local region bid allocation to the Girls’ Junior National Championship tournament to be held in Columbus, Ohio later this season. The top 12 teams in each age group (except U12, which is at eight teams) will compete for one of two bids (National & American), starting with the U12-U14 age groups this Saturday, May 5. Eight ITVC teams qualified for the opportunity to compete for a bid through the Power League tournament series. The four remaining ITVC teams will compete for a bid in the u15-U18 age divisions on Saturday, May 12.
